The Duck Cup Memorial

 

We are a nonprofit organization that is dedicated to providing resources for mental health awareness and suicide prevention. Our sponsored events reach over 30,000 students, parents, teachers, and community members on an annual basis.

We started this organization understanding that we would never truly know the number of lives we might be saving. We know our speaking events are positively impacting lives, and we also know that Mental Health education is necessary!  There are many people out there hurting that need to know it's ok to ask for help.  It's ok to not be ok.

New Prague Area Suicide Grief Support Group

For anyone who has lost a family member, friend, or loved one to suicide, We are a mutual self-help group, sponsored by the Mayo Clinic Health System in New Prague, and meet on the fourth Tuesday of every month from 7:00-8:30 PM. Meetings are held at the Duck Cup Memorial Center of Hope located at 105 Central Ave South, New Prague, MN.

There is no fee to attend and there is no pre-registration.
